« Previous | Next » 

Revision e57893cd


Added by Christos Stavrakakis almost 11 years ago

cyclades: Do not delete networks with floating IPs

Forbid network deletion in case the network has allocated floating IPs,
no matter whether they are used by instances or not. Update
'allocate_floating_ip' API method, to take exclusive lock on network
before reserving a floating IP, to avoid race condition between deleting
a network and reserving an IP address.


  • added
  • modified
  • copied
  • renamed
  • deleted

View differences